Replacing your windows involves several moving parts that change the final bill. The biggest factor is the frame material, as vinyl tends to be more budget-friendly while wood or custom fiberglass options sit on the higher end. You also have to consider the glass packages—things like double versus triple panes or extra coatings for energy efficiency can shift the cost. The complexity of the installation matters, too, such as whether your frames need repairs or if you are switching from a standard window to a bay or bow style.
